About Edward Morris

Immigrated to America Feb. 23, 1652/3. Settled in Roxbury, MA. & was the Constable in 1664. Selectman 1674-1687. Deputy to the General Court 1677-1687 & was one of the leading first settlers to Woodstock where he was Selectman (1688 'til death) & the first military officer. He & his descendants adopted the 'Morris' spelling. Woodstock Hill Cemt. ~ gravestone states, 'Here lies buried the body of Lieut. Edward Morris. Deceas'd September 1690......'

Source: 'History of Woodstock', by Bowen
